What is a Hydrogen Energy Electric Single Seat Regulating Valve? A Hydrogen Energy Electric Single Seat Regulating Valve is a device used to control the flow and pressure of hydrogen gas in a hydrogen-based system. It utilizes an electric actuator to precisely regulate the opening and closing of the valve, which helps manage the flow of hydrogen gas based on the system’s requirements. The term “single seat” refers to the valve’s design, which uses a single sealing element to control the flow, making it particularly suitable for applications requiring precision control of fluid or gas.
